Arguments:

Advantages

1- Remote communication

The most obvious advantage of the media is that they facilitate remote communication.

Thanks to electronic devices (phones, computers, tablets, among others) it is possible to talk in
real time with people who are not in the same country.

2- They are immediate

Before there were electronic devices, remote communication was done through postal mail.

A lot of time could pass between the issuance of the letter and the reception of an answer, which
made the communication not particularly effective.

However, thanks to the advances in communication today, remote interaction can be


immediate.

There are different types of platforms that make this type of communication possible. Social
networks like Facebook and Twitter and applications like WhatsApp are some examples of these.

3- Distance study

Previously, distance courses could be taken by correspondence. However, the process could be
tedious due to slow mail.

At present, information and communication technologies have favored distance study. In this
way, students can stay at home while learning through various platforms, such as social
networks.

4- Globalization
The media have increased the globalization process . Distance communication has not only
made countries closer culturally, but has also allowed the world economy to be unified in some
way.

5- They are cheap

Once they have been developed, the media are economical for its users.

For example, email and social networks have no additional costs in addition to paying for the
internet service. In any case, sending an email from Mexico to China is much cheaper than
making a phone call.

7- Advertising

The media is a way of promoting services and products. In this sense, they constitute an
advantage in the area of advertising and marketing.

8- Mass dissemination of information

Many media outlets are massive, such as radio, television and the newspaper. In this
sense, they allow the dissemination of information quickly and effectively, reaching
a large part of the population.

Disadvantages

Although they offer multiple benefits, the media have a number of

disadvantages. Below are some of these.

1- They depend on technology

The media depend directly on the technology. This means that if technology collapses
the media will do the same.

Because the technology is not perfect, it often fails. For example, social media
platforms may fail when data transfer is excessive.
2- Create dependency

Human beings can develop dependence on the media. The cell phone is one of the
technological devices in communication that is more addictive.

3- They are not always reliable

Among the advantages of the media, the importance of their mass character was
mentioned. This characteristic may be negative if the information transmitted is not
true.

In social networks, non-verifiable information or from unreliable sources is often


disseminated, which can lead to problems.
